The NZP has brought forth this bill for consideration by our esteemed colleagues because
It is reasonable to think that an adult would need to protect themselves against those who intend to do them harm. For those of you who may say "Well if nobody had guns than we would not need guns to protect ourselves." My response is that it is not the law abiding and and socially productive citizens that we must worry about, but it is those that wish to promote anarchy and pursue criminal activities that we must be able to protect ourselves from. The possibility that a citizen my own a gun is a strong deterrent to those who wish to hurt their fellow countrymen. Of Course there will be strict limitations and requirements for weapon ownership and we believe these limitations will only put weapons in the hands of those who are responsible enough to handle them.
